When the company, Instart Logic, was founded a few years ago, it was created with a simple mission. The goal was to bring an intelligent, fast and scalable solution to face the challenges of application delivery to companies whose business depends on cloud application performance. It was a company designed to provide a cloud-based service for Web publishers to improve site performance over both mobile and Wi-Fi networks.
Back in 2013, the company raised $17 million is Series B funding. This week, Instart Logic announced that it has raised an additional $43 million in a funding round that was led by Four Rivers Group and Hermes Partners. This brings the company’s new total funding up to $95 million.
Instart Logic wasted no time in putting its expansion funding into play as they also announced three key recent hires. Rafael Torres was hired as the company’s chief financial officer (CFO), Shailesh Shukla as vice president of products and strategy and Justin Fitzhugh as vice president of technical operations. All three bring a lot to the table as each has many years of experience in their selected postions.

Below are a few key facts about Instart Logic:
- Instart Logic is one of the fastest growing companies in the application delivery market and recorded fivefold sales growth in 2014, with more than 400 high-volume websites running on its Software-Defined Application Delivery (SDAD) platform.

- According to a recent study from leading global advisory firm Enterprise Strategy Group (News - Alert) (ESG), for the top 30 e-commerce websites based on the Keynote Mobile Commerce Performance Index, SDAD delivers a 75 percent overall reduction in mobile website load times as compared to traditional content delivery networks (CDNs).
- Instart Logic has filed close to 40 patents to date and authored several papers, contributing learned technological insights back to the research community.
